Sat 692034552432702

decimal
138406.4552432702
degree
0°138406′1318″4552432702‴
percentile
32.95402634256859%
name
iyhfptjiybr
cycle
0
epoch
0
period
68
block
138406
offset
4552432702
rarity
common
timestamp